Merge revision 542 changes:
- Add CefCookieManager interface and CefRequestHandler::GetCookieManager for custom cookie handling (issue #542). - Support getting and setting cookies with custom scheme handlers (issue #555). - Support calling CefFrame::GetIdentifier and CefFrame::GetURL on any thread (issue #556). git-svn-id: https://chromiumembedded.googlecode.com/svn/branches/1025@543 5089003a-bbd8-11dd-ad1f-f1f9622dbc98
